Starting Pitching Matchup

Jack Kochanowicz will start for the Angels here and is 1-0 with a 3.27 ERA and 8 strikeouts this season. This will be Kochanowicz’s first career start against the Astros. The Houston Astros will send out Ronel Blanco in this one, and Blanco is 0-1 with a 9.45 ERA and 9 strikeouts this season. In his career, Blanco is 3-0 with a 2.08 ERA and 19 strikeouts against the Angels.

Los Angeles Angels Recap

The Los Angeles Angels come into this series after their 11-1 win in Thursday’s rubber match with the Tampa Bay Rays to improve to 8-4 on the year. After this set, the Angels will head on the road for another division series against the Texas Rangers.

Angels Win Another Series To Start The Year

Logan O’Hoppe has 14 hits, including a team-high 5 home runs and 9 RBIs, while Nolan Schanuel has 13 hits with 2 doubles, a triple, and 5 RBIs. Luis Rengifo has a team-high 3 doubles with his 10 hits, and Taylor Ward also has 12 hits as well, while Mike Trout’s added 5 home runs and 11 RBIs so far this season. Jorge Soler also has 3 home runs but also has the unfortunate distinction of leading the Angels with 18 strikeouts so far this season. Kyren Paris has also chipped in 11 hits with a triple, 5 home runs, and 8 RBIs.

Houston Astros Recap

The Houston Astros come into this set off of their 7-6 loss to the Seattle Mariners in Wednesday’s rubber match with the Seattle Mariners to fall to 5-7 on the year. After this series, the Astros will head on the road for a series against the St. Louis Cardinals.

Astros Trying To Find Consistency

Jose Altuve leads the Astros with 18 hits, including 3 home runs and 6 RBIs. Jeremy Pena also has a pair of solo homers and 4 stolen bases, while Yordan Alvarez has a double and a team-high 8 RBIs with 12 strikeouts as well. Brendan Rodgers has a pair of doubles, while Jake Meyers has a pair of doubles as well, and Christian Walker has also accrued a team-high 18 strikeouts so far this season.
